我们需要将使用 unsigned char 作为位掩码的程序升级到使用 unsigned short 作为位掩码的较新版本。我相信它们之间存在一些差异,因为我们的程序使用相同的逻辑失败,将 unsigned char 更改为 unsigned short。(那是我们买的外部库。库升级了,所以我们也需要更改程序)。

Old version:
typedef struct SomeStruct {
    unsigned char   bit_mask;
#       define      SomeStruct_a_present 0x80
#       define      SomeStruct_b_present 0x40
#       define      SomeStruct_c_present 0x20
    X          x;
    Y          y;
    A          a;  /* optional; set in bit_mask
                                * SomeStruct_a_present if
                                * present */

    B          b;  /* optional; set in bit_mask
                                * SomeStruct_b_present if
                                * present */

    C          c;  /* optional; set in bit_mask
                                * SomeStruct_c_present if
                                * present */
} SomeStruct;



New version:
typedef struct SomeStruct {
    unsigned short   bit_mask;
#       define      SomeStruct_x_present 0x8000
#       define      SomeStruct_y_present 0x4000
#       define      SomeStruct_a_present 0x2000
#       define      SomeStruct_b_present 0x1000
#       define      SomeStruct_c_present 0x0800
    X          x;/* optional; set in bit_mask
                                * SomeStruct_x_present if
                                * present */
    Y          y;/* optional; set in bit_mask
                                * SomeStruct_y_present if
                                * present */
    A          a;  /* optional; set in bit_mask
                                * SomeStruct_a_present if
                                * present */

    B          b;  /* optional; set in bit_mask
                                * SomeStruct_b_present if
                                * present */

    C          c;  /* optional; set in bit_mask
                                * SomeStruct_c_present if
                                * present */
} SomeStruct;

我认为我们当前的行存在一些问题,因为程序崩溃了:

我们当前设置 bit_mask 的方法:

someStruct.bit_mask = SomeStruct_a_present;
someStruct.bit_mask |= SomeStruct_b_present;
someStruct.bit_mask |= SomeStruct_c_present;

无符号短此行

someStruct.bit_mask = SomeStruct_a_present;

将位掩码的值设置为8192,但使用 unsigned char 的值将设置为128

原因:

unsigned short 长度为 2 个字节,位掩码为0010000000000000( 0x2000),但是对于 unsigned char,该值将为10000000( 0x80)。
